Tire Designs Broken Down
Choosing the correct tires for a automobile can significantly impact protection, operation, and energy consumption. There are several types of tires available, each made for particular driving conditions and specifications. All-season tires offer a harmonious performance for various weather conditions, making them a popular choice for regular commuting. In contrast, winter tires are built with custom tread patterns and rubber compounds to provide superior traction on snow and ice. Performance tires, designed for sports cars, enhance handling and cornering capabilities at higher speeds. Off-road tires feature bold treads for enhanced grip on rugged terrains. Understanding these distinctions allows vehicle owners to decide on tires that best suit their driving style and the environment in which they operate.
Understanding Tire Requirements
Comprehending tire specifications is crucial for guaranteeing optimal functionality and safety in any automobile. Each tire comes with a series of specifications, including width, aspect ratio, and diameter, which are marked on the sidewall. The width, calculated in millimeters, influences traction and handling, while the aspect ratio reflects the tire's height relative to its width, affecting ride comfort. Additionally, the diameter, expressed in inches, must match the vehicle's rim size for proper fitment. Other significant factors include load index and speed rating, which establish how much weight a tire can carry and its maximum speed capability. Choosing the appropriate tires based on these specifications enhances driving experience, improves fuel efficiency, and ensures safety on the road.

Improved Tire Durability
Tire rotations are crucial for increasing tire longevity by promoting even wear throughout all tires. This routine helps balance the weight and forces acting on each individual tire, which may differ according to their position on the vehicle. Front tires often undergo greater wear due to steering and braking forces, while rear tires may wear differently based on driving habits and road conditions. Performing regular rotations, typically recommended every 5,000 to 8,000 miles, can significantly extend the life of tires, delaying the need for replacements. By ensuring even tire wear, vehicle owners can achieve enhanced performance, safety, and cost-effectiveness over time, ultimately maximizing their investment in tire maintenance.

Flat Tire Repair Answers and Excellent Tire Upgrades
When encountering a flat tire, drivers have several effective choices to contemplate for quick repairs and long-term upgrades. Speedy solutions often involve utilizing tire sealers or plugs, which can temporarily seal small splits and allow drivers to reach a service station. However, for a more durable solution, professional patching or exchange is endorsed, particularly for larger damages.
Alongside repairs, upgrading to higher-quality tires can increase overall performance and safety. All-season or high-performance tires can provide better traction and handling, whereas run-flat tires offer the perk of driving short distances after a puncture, avoiding the immediate need for a replacement. Drivers should also consider investing in regular tire maintenance, including rotations and pressure checks, to extend tire life and prevent future flats. In the end, a combination of effective repair strategies and quality upgrades can assure that drivers remain safe and mobile on the road.
Frequently Requested Questions
Can I Identify if My Tires Are Compromised?
To determine if tires are deteriorated, one should inspect tread depth, looking for wear indicators. Cracks, bulges, and uneven wear patterns also signal potential issues. Frequent inspections and observation can ensure safe driving conditions.
What Is the Duration of a Standard Tire?
The lifespan of a standard tire ranges from 25,000 to 50,000 miles, based on factors like how you drive, upkeep, and road conditions. Routine checks can help determine when a tire requires replacement.
Can I Mount Different Tire Types on My Automobile?
Blending different tire brands on a vehicle is typically not advisable. Differences in tread patterns, rubber compounds, and performance characteristics can lead to uneven wear, compromised handling, and decreased safety, potentially affecting overall driving stability.
What must I Do if I develop a Tire Blowout?
Should a tire blowout take place, the driver must stay calm, maintain a strong grip the steering wheel, slowly decrease speed, and carefully pull over to a safe spot before assessing the damage and contacting help.
How Do I Correctly Store My Tires?
To correctly store tires, wash them thoroughly, arrange them vertically in a cool, dry area protected from direct sunlight, and ensure they are not pressing against their sidewalls to preserve their shape and integrity.
